These surplus animals are either killed - and sometimes fed to their fellow zoo habitants - or sold to other zoos or dealers. Selling animals is a profitable way for zoos to dispose of them. Dealers will sell them to hunting ranches, pet shops, circuses, the exotic meat industry, and research facilities. read more
